Oil Leak
Over the weekend I noticed tiny patch of oil on the undertray. There are traces of oil on the alternator. Visual inspection was difficult but the source will be something around the oil filter which is above the alternator. Hopefully it's not the oil filter housing or oil cooler...
I took one photo by removing the drivers side fog light grill where you can see the alternator. As the air filter box and ducting is roughly above the oil filter housing, will I get a better look if I remove these? Also, is this a known leaky area on the V8's?
